ParliamentBench measures LLM deception capacity through social game simulation

Researchers have built ParliamentBench, an open-source evaluation framework grounded in the social deduction game Secret Hitler, to systematically measure whether LLMs can deceive, persuade, and reason under information asymmetry. Testing 16 models across 1,600 matches against each other and humans, the work introduces three novel metrics isolating deception consistency from general reasoning ability. The findings matter for AI safety: as language models move into high-stakes domains like medicine and law, understanding their capacity for strategic dishonesty and adversarial behavior becomes a prerequisite for deployment governance, not an afterthought.

The key insight isn't that LLMs can deceive (they hallucinate under pressure already), but that ParliamentBench separates deception consistency from general reasoning ability through three novel metrics. This distinction matters because a model might reason well overall yet systematically lie under information asymmetry, a failure mode invisible to standard benchmarks.
